What companies run services between Cologne, Germany and Ærøskøbing, Denmark?

There is no direct connection from Cologne to Ærøskøbing. However, you can take the train to Hamburg Hbf, take the train to Odense St., take the train to Svendborg St., walk to Svendborg Færgehavn, then take the ferry to Ærøskøbing Havn.
